Chinese Antique Ink Stick / Cake Scholar & Attendants
CHINESE ANTIQUE INK STICK / CAKE
SCHOLAR & ATTENDANTS
A COLLECTORS TREASURE FOR THE SCHOLARS STUDIO
QING DYNASTY (1644-1911)
A superb ink cake in the shape of a semi circle.
The front displaying seated scholar and attendants in a landscape.
The reverse with calligraphy and seal mark
Calligraphy on the edge, reads "Cheng Junfang Ink"
"Ink made by Cheng Junfang during the Wanli period of the Ming Dynasty in China (1573-1620). Cheng was a famous ink maker in the Ming Dynasty. He was from Shexian County, Anhui Province.
He was as famous as Fang Yulu, an ink maker at the time, and was known as "Equation".
